Causes of Erectile Dysfunction

Erectile dysfunction (ED) can have various causes, including physical, psychological, and lifestyle factors.

Physical causes

Physical causes of erectile dysfunction include underlying health conditions that affect blood flow or nerve function. Conditions such as heart disease, high blood pressure, diabetes, obesity, and hormonal imbalances can contribute to ED. Additionally, certain medications, such as antidepressants and blood pressure medications, may also hinder erectile function.

Psychological causes

Psychological factors, such as stress, anxiety, depression, and relationship problems, can play a significant role in erectile dysfunction. These emotional factors can disrupt the signal transmission between the brain and the nerves responsible for triggering an erection.

Lifestyle factors

Unhealthy lifestyle choices, including excessive alcohol consumption, smoking, and drug use, can contribute to erectile dysfunction. Lack of regular exercise, poor nutrition, and unhealthy weight management can also affect erectile strength.

Medical Treatments

There are various medical treatments available for erectile dysfunction that can help restore erectile strength and improve sexual performance.

Oral medications

Oral medications, such as Viagra, Cialis, and Levitra, are commonly prescribed to treat erectile dysfunction. These medications work by increasing blood flow to the penis, resulting in improved erections. It is essential to consult with a healthcare professional before taking any oral medication to ensure they are safe for you.

Injections and suppositories

For individuals who do not respond well to oral medications, injections and suppositories may be recommended. Medications, such as alprostadil, can be injected directly into the base or side of the penis, helping to achieve and maintain an erection. Suppositories, which are inserted into the urethra, can also facilitate erections.

Vacuum erection devices

A vacuum erection device (VED) is a non-invasive treatment option that uses a pump to create a vacuum and draw blood into the penis, resulting in an erection. A tension ring is placed at the base of the penis to maintain the erection. VEDs may be suitable for individuals who prefer not to take medications or undergo surgical procedures.

Penile implants

Penile implants are surgically inserted devices that allow men with erectile dysfunction to achieve an erection. There are two main types of penile implants: inflatable implants and malleable implants. Inflatable implants consist of a fluid-filled reservoir and a pump that is activated to inflate or deflate the implant. Malleable implants are bendable rods that can be manually adjusted to create an erection.

Testosterone replacement therapy

If low testosterone levels are contributing to erectile dysfunction, testosterone replacement therapy may be recommended. This treatment involves replacing or boosting testosterone levels through various methods, such as injections, gels, patches, or pellets. Testosterone replacement therapy can help improve sexual function and may be beneficial for individuals with documented low testosterone levels.

Surgery

In some cases, surgery may be necessary to treat erectile dysfunction. Surgical procedures, such as vascular surgery or reconstructive surgery, can help improve blood flow to the penis. However, surgery is typically considered a last-resort option when other treatments have been unsuccessful.

Lifestyle Changes

Making certain lifestyle changes can significantly improve erectile strength and overall sexual function.

Regular exercise

Engaging in regular exercise, such as cardiovascular exercises, strength training, and pelvic floor exercises, can improve blood flow and promote overall cardiovascular health. Exercise can also help maintain a healthy weight and reduce the risk of underlying health conditions that contribute to erectile dysfunction.

Healthy diet

A balanced and nutritious diet rich in fruits, vegetables, whole grains, lean proteins, and healthy fats can support overall sexual health. Consuming foods that promote good cardiovascular health, such as those rich in antioxidants and omega-3 fatty acids, can also help improve erectile function.

Weight management

Maintaining a healthy weight is crucial for optimal erectile function. Obesity and excess body fat can contribute to hormonal imbalances, insulin resistance, and poor blood flow, all of which can negatively impact erectile strength. By adopting healthy eating habits and engaging in regular physical activity, weight management can be achieved.

Reducing alcohol consumption

Excessive alcohol consumption can decrease sexual desire and impair erectile function. Limiting alcohol intake or abstaining from alcohol altogether can help improve sexual performance and overall sexual health.

Quitting smoking

Smoking damages blood vessels and decreases blood flow throughout the body, including to the penis. Quitting smoking can improve erectile function and reduce the risk of developing cardiovascular conditions that contribute to ED.

Stress management

Chronic stress can have a detrimental impact on sexual function and erectile strength. Engaging in stress-reducing activities such as meditation, yoga, deep breathing exercises, and hobbies can help alleviate stress and improve overall well-being.

Natural Remedies and Supplements

Several natural remedies and supplements have been suggested to improve erectile dysfunction. However, it is important to note that these remedies may not be scientifically proven and should be used with caution.

Acupuncture

Acupuncture, an ancient Chinese practice that involves inserting thin needles into specific points of the body, has been suggested as a potential treatment for erectile dysfunction. Some studies have shown promising results, but more research is needed to determine its effectiveness.

Herbal supplements

Certain herbal supplements, such as ginkgo biloba, horny goat weed, and Tribulus terrestris, are believed to improve erectile function. However, it is important to consult with a healthcare professional before taking any herbal supplements, as they may interact with other medications or have potential side effects.

L-arginine

L-arginine is an amino acid that helps produce nitric oxide, a substance that promotes blood vessel dilation and improved blood flow. Some studies suggest that L-arginine supplements may be beneficial for erectile dysfunction, but further research is needed to confirm its effectiveness.

Panax ginseng

Panax ginseng, also known as Korean ginseng, has been used in traditional medicine to improve sexual performance. Some studies suggest that Panax ginseng may have a positive effect on erectile function, but more research is needed to establish its efficacy.

Yohimbe

Yohimbe is derived from the bark of an African tree and has been used as a traditional aphrodisiac. It is believed to improve erectile function by increasing blood flow to the penis. However, yohimbe can have adverse side effects and should be used with caution under the guidance of a healthcare professional.

DHEA

Dehydroepiandrosterone (DHEA) is a hormone that is naturally produced by the body. Some studies have shown that DHEA supplements may improve erectile function, particularly in individuals with low DHEA levels. However, more research is needed to determine its effectiveness and safety.

Zinc

Zinc is an essential mineral that plays a role in several bodily functions, including testosterone production. Some studies suggest that zinc supplementation may benefit individuals with zinc deficiencies, which can contribute to erectile dysfunction. However, it is important to consult with a healthcare professional before taking any mineral or vitamin supplements.

Exercises for Erectile Dysfunction

Certain exercises can help improve erectile function by strengthening the pelvic floor muscles, increasing blood flow, and improving overall physical fitness.

Kegel exercises

Kegel exercises involve contracting and relaxing the pelvic floor muscles, which are responsible for controlling urinary flow and supporting erectile function. Regularly performing Kegel exercises can help strengthen these muscles and improve erectile strength.

Pelvic floor exercises

Beyond Kegel exercises, additional pelvic floor exercises, such as leg lifts, bridges, and squats, can help strengthen the pelvic floor muscles. These exercises contribute to better blood flow and support erectile function.

Aerobic exercises

Engaging in aerobic exercises, such as brisk walking, jogging, swimming, or cycling, can improve cardiovascular health and promote better blood flow throughout the body, including to the penis. Aim for at least 150 minutes of moderate-intensity aerobic exercise per week.

Yoga poses

Certain yoga poses, such as the Bridge pose, Cobra pose, and Child’s pose, can help improve blood flow to the pelvic region and promote flexibility and strength. Incorporating yoga into your exercise routine may support overall sexual health and enhance erectile strength.

When to Seek Medical Help

While occasional episodes of erectile dysfunction are common and may not warrant immediate medical attention, certain situations may indicate the need for professional help.

Persistent or recurring erectile dysfunction

If you consistently experience difficulty achieving or maintaining an erection, it is essential to consult with a healthcare professional. Persistent or recurring erectile dysfunction may be indicative of underlying health conditions that require medical intervention.

Underlying health conditions

If you have been diagnosed with health conditions such as heart disease, diabetes, or hormonal imbalances, it is important to inform your healthcare provider about any difficulties with erectile function. Addressing these conditions can help prevent or manage erectile dysfunction effectively.

Side effects of medications

If you notice changes in your erectile function after starting a new medication, it is advisable to consult with your healthcare provider. They can evaluate the potential side effects of the medication and explore alternative options.

Emotional or relationship issues

Emotional or relationship issues that significantly impact erectile function may require the expertise of a psychologist or therapist. Seeking professional help can provide valuable support and guidance in addressing these concerns.
